What companies run services between Port Jefferson, NY, USA and Boston, MA, USA?

There is no direct connection from Port Jefferson to Boston. However, you can take the car ferry to Bridgeport, walk to Bridgeport Amtrak Station, then take the train to Boston. Alternatively, you can take a car ferry from Port Jefferson to Boston via Bridgeport, Bridgeport Bus Stop, and Hartford Union Station in around 6h 45m.
